Carruthersia is a genus of plants in the family Apocynaceae first described as a genus in 1866. It is native to the Philippines and to certain islands of the Western Pacific.
Species Carruthersia glabra D.J.Middleton - Samar Island in Philippines Carruthersia latifolia Gillespie - Fiji, Tonga Carruthersia pilosa (A.DC.) Fern.-Vill. - Philippines, Solomon Islands, possibly Vanuatu Carruthersia scandens (Seem.) Seem. - Fiji
